Sammy Gyamfi, CEO of Ghana Gold Board, has refuted allegations of insulting Minority Leader Alexander Afenyo-Markin. The dispute stemmed from a recent discussion concerning losses incurred by the Gold Board. Gyamfi asserts he did not initiate the disrespectful tone, but rather responded in kind to prior remarks directed at him. He maintains his response was a justified reaction and not an unprovoked attack. This clarification comes after a contentious exchange between the two figures, drawing public attention to the Gold Board's financial issues. Gyamfi believes Afenyo-Markin received a response commensurate with his own initial statements. The situation highlights ongoing tensions between government officials and opposition members regarding accountability and transparency.
